On a beautiful spring morning, April 19th, 2025, the streets of Downtown Hattiesburg, Mississippi came alive with energy, purpose, and community spirit as we hosted our inaugural Rabbit Run — a 5K and 1-Mile Fun Run benefiting single parents and children of single-parent homes.
In partnership with the incredible team at Southern Prohibition Brewery, we welcomed over 130 enthusiastic runners and walkers who laced up their shoes, donned their bunny ears, and hit the pavement not just for fitness and fun — but for a cause that truly matters.
The atmosphere buzzed with music, laughter, and heartfelt moments as families, friends, and community members gathered to show their support. From the first stretch to the final cheers at the finish line, it was clear that this wasn’t just a race — it was a movement.
And the best part? Thanks to your generosity and participation, we raised enough funds to cover a full semester of tuition for one of our Build Better Scholars — a single parent working toward a brighter future through education.
